Responsibilities include schedule and execution of compliance and/or licensing activities related to inspections, allegations, Notices of Violation, Nuclear Regulatory Commission (NRC) interface, and regulatory correspondence. This position is posted in a range, and an offer will be made based on candidate's qualifications. Independently coordinate the evaluation, preparation, processing, and submittal of regulatory correspondence, including Licensee Event Reports, Notice of Violation responses, and License Amendment Requests. Independently provide technical assistance and guidance to plant personnel in evaluating plant conditions requiring NRC notification. Independently provide Technical Specification guidance to plant on clarifications and interpretations. Conduct event analyses and make recommendations on reportability. Independently facilitate and coordinate work activity of others to perform routine regulatory tasks ensure all work activities are performed in accordance with the policies, practices, standards, and rules of the company as well as those regulations and procedures required by external agencies. Interface with NRC Resident Inspectors, Regional Inspectors, NRR Project Manager, and other NRC staff to manage NRC Inspections and to support NRR review of requested licensing actions. Support and participate in the Emergency Plan Organization and Corrective Action program activities as assigned and in accordance with procedures and policies applicable for the assigned role.
